Differentiate `x^(sinx - cosx)+(x^2-1)/(x^2+1)` with respect to `x` .

To differentiate the function \( y = x^{\sin x - \cos x} + \frac{x^2 - 1}{x^2 + 1} \) with respect to \( x \), we will break it down into two parts: \( u = x^{\sin x - \cos x} \) and \( v = \frac{x^2 - 1}{x^2 + 1} \). ### Step 1: Differentiate \( u = x^{\sin x - \cos x} \) 1. **Take the natural logarithm of both sides**: \[ \log u = (\sin x - \cos x) \log x \] ...
